Subtract 98/18 from 15/5

1st number: 3 0/5, 2nd number: 5 8/18

15/5 - 98/18 is -22/9.

Steps for subtracting f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 5 and 18 is 90

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 90
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 5 × 18 = 90,
    15/5 = 15 × 18/5 × 18 = 270/90
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 18 × 5 = 90,
    98/18 = 98 × 5/18 × 5 = 490/90
  4. Subtract the two like fractions:
    270/90 - 490/90 = 270 - 490/90 = -220/90
  5. After reducing the fraction, the answer is -22/9
